WebInformation on Greek-American and Greek national identity was gathered among Greek-American residents and temporary Greek na-tional visitors in Tucson, Arizona, a city of about 400,000 people. In Tucson, a formally organized Greek-American church community is supported by the membership of approximately 150 families.
